I had already made a post about this aquarium and my concerns about there being no bracing and the plastic bracing all being separate pieces.
I was told that this aquarium would be strong and that I have nothing to worry about.
I decided to go ahead with this build. The aquarium sits on a leveled Alufab aquarium stand with a 1/2" piece of HDPE under the bottom trim
I finally filled the aquarium up and at the top I am getting almost a 3/8" inch bow across the 48" panels.
Should I just cut my losses and sell this aquarium?

I have a mega matrix 300 and it is a tank. I’d trust their construction.
I contacted planet aquariums and the bowing was within spec. 1875" per side and they allow up the .25"
The 120 unfortunately doesn't have any euro bracing or cross braces like the 300 does.
My 120 most likely would have been fine for many years but now I'll be able to sleep better with the glass cross brace.

120 with glass cross brace installed.
I started with a non-drilled mega matrix 120 and drilled it myself to fit a Modular Marine overflow.
Note to anyone else wanting to do this; make sure to order a mega matrix without the black background. The heat used during their coating process partially tempers the back panel of glass.
This is another reason I feel more comfortable with he cross brace due to the tank being modified.

So did it stop the bowing?also how much was the tank and the shipping? I'm thinking about getting this same tank
It stopped the bowing and the front panel is completely flat when checking it with a level. I am very happy with how it turned out.
It probably wasn't necessary but I feel better about it now.
I paid around 1600 shipped to Southern Michigan from aquarium specialty. This was with all standard glass panels, no painted background and no overflow box.
